Verwenden Sie die Python via .NET Bibliothek, um DOCX Dateien in Teile aufzuteilen. Sie können die extrahierten DOCX Seiten mit anderen Daten integrieren und erhalten als Ergebnis Dokumente in Form und Inhalt, die Sie benötigen. Das Aufteilen von DOCX in Teile erleichtert die Zusammenarbeit an DOCX Dateien.
Diese Softwarebibliothek stellt Python Entwicklern eine Reihe von Funktionen zur Verfügung, um DOCX Dateien in Teile aufzuteilen. Das Aufteilen eines DOCX Dokuments in separate Dateien kann verwendet werden, um das parallele Arbeiten mit Abschnitten eines Dokuments zu erleichtern. Wenn beispielsweise mehrere Personen gleichzeitig an einem Wort arbeiten, können sie die Arbeit durch Aufteilen von DOCX beschleunigen. Das Aufteilen von DOCX Dokumenten kann Teil einer Technologie zum Extrahieren von Text aus DOCX Dateien und zum Integrieren von Daten in automatisierte Informationssysteme oder Datenbanken sein.
Unsere Bibliothek stellt Python Entwicklern alle notwendigen Funktionen zur Verfügung, um DOCX in Teile aufzuteilen und Seiten gemäß dem angegebenen Modus zu extrahieren. Dies ist eine eigenständige Python via .NET Lösung, für die Microsoft Word, Acrobat Reader oder andere Anwendungen nicht installiert werden müssen.
Teilen Sie den DOCX Inhalt anhand verschiedener Kriterien im Python Code auf. Sie können die folgenden Seitenextraktionsmodi für DOCX Dokumente verwenden: 'Aufteilen nach Überschriften', 'Aufteilen nach Abschnitten', 'Aufteilen Seite nach Seite', 'Aufteilen nach Seitenbereichen'.
Nachdem Sie Ihre DOCX Datei in Teile aufgeteilt haben, können Sie das Ergebnis mit der Methode 'Document.Save' in das gewünschte Dateiformat exportieren. Sie können auch steuern, wie die DOCX Dokumentteile in HTML oder EPUB exportiert werden, indem Sie die Eigenschaft 'DocumentPartSavingCallback' verwenden, mit der Sie Ausgabeströme umleiten können.
Teilen Sie DOCX Dokumente ganz einfach mit unserer Lösung für Python via .NET. Das folgende Beispiel zeigt, wie Sie ein DOCX Dokument mit Python:
pip install aspose-words
Kopieren
import aspose.words as aw
doc = aw.Document("Input.docx")
for page in range(0, doc.page_count):
extractedPage = doc.extract_pages(page, 1)
extractedPage.save(f"Output_{page + 1}.docx")
Wir hosten unsere Python Pakete in PyPi- Repositorys. Bitte befolgen Sie die Schritt-für-Schritt-Anleitung zur Installation von "Aspose.Words for Python via .NET" in Ihrer Entwicklerumgebung.
Dieses Paket ist mit Python ≥3.5 und <3.12 kompatibel. Wenn Sie Software für Linux entwickeln, schauen Sie sich bitte die zusätzlichen Anforderungen für gcc und libpython in der Produktdokumentation an.